Has anyone had any dealing with Newgateway.citymaker.com for a personal loan


I haven't heard about this company. Did you find them in the internet or do they have a physical location in your area? Most of the loan companies in the internet are turning out to be scams. It rings a bell when they ask people to send some money upfront in the form of insurance or likewise. Keep in mind, a good loan company will never ask for money upfront before the money is deposited in the account. What is your company offering you?

I checked it over and it looks a little iffy to me. There is no contact information for this company, no About Us page or anything. Just a form you fill out with your information and they call you to talk about it. I suspect a charismatic salesperson with a good voice will call and convince you to give them more information like a bank account or something.

I checked the BBB and didn't find anything exact of course since I didn't have anything to go on but a website address. Found a New Gateway in NY, they have 6 complaints since being opened in September last year. They also state information about advance loan fee and credit card scams but "not intended as a report on any specific company."

So they aren't outright calling them a scam, but that is suspicious enough for me.
